Unlike the first Pikmin, Pikmin 2 does not involve a time limit. Thus, the game has a more relaxed pace than its predecessor.
Red Pikmin are arguably the simplest Pikmin, in both form and function. They have high attack power and can withstand fire, whereas the other types of Pikmin look stranger and have a wider variety of uses. Also, you do not come into fire hazards early in either game, which means the more common electric and water hazards block a larger area of the world. Lastly, white and purple Pikmin could not be the first Pikmin you get in Pikmin 2 because they can only be created in caverns you need Pikmin to enter in the first place.
